A
Zoo in the Sky
by Jacqueline Mitton
This gorgeous picture book introduces children to the constellations
that are named for animals. Mitton also offers a brief introduction
to the constellations and two pages of related discussion on astronomy.
A lovely choice for anyone interested in the mysteries of the night
sky. For ages 6-10. |

Amateur
Telescope Making
by Stephen Tonkin
An introduction to the design of a variety of telescopes, mounts,
and drives suitable for the home-constructor. Projects include instruments
that range from a shoestring budget to specialist devices that are
not commercially available. |
